Historical Origins of the Chaise Lounge

The chaise lounge traces its roots back to ancient Egypt, where it was a symbol of status and comfort. Royals and nobles reclined on elongated chairs during social gatherings and official ceremonies. This concept of reclining furniture spread to ancient Greece and Rome, where it was integrated into their social and dining customs. The term "chaise lounge" itself is derived from the French "chaise longue," meaning "long chair." During the Rococo and Neoclassical periods, the chaise lounge became a fashionable fixture in European drawing rooms, adorned with intricate carvings and sumptuous fabrics.

Design and Ergonomics

At its core, the chaise lounge is designed to support the body in a reclined position, promoting relaxation and comfort. Ergonomically, it allows for a semi-reclined posture that reduces pressure on the spine and encourages circulation. Modern designs often incorporate adjustable backrests and contours that align with the body's natural curves. The length of the chaise allows users to stretch out fully, providing support for the head, back, and legs. Materials used range from plush upholstery for indoor models to weather-resistant fabrics and frames for outdoor versions, ensuring durability without compromising comfort.

Materials and Styles

Chaise lounges come in a variety of materials to suit different environments and preferences. Outdoor chaises are typically constructed with materials such as teak, aluminum, or synthetic wicker to withstand weather conditions. For example, aluminum frames are lightweight and resistant to rust, making them ideal for poolside chaise settings. Indoor chaises often feature wooden frames with plush cushions for maximum comfort. Style-wise, options range from classic designs with ornate details to sleek, modern silhouettes. The choice of color, fabric, and finish allows for personalization to match any décor.

Maintenance and Care Tips

Proper maintenance extends the life of a chaise lounge. For outdoor models, regular cleaning to remove dirt and debris is essential. Use mild soap and water for surfaces and follow manufacturer guidelines for any specific care instructions. Protecting the chaise from extreme weather conditions with covers or storage during off-seasons can prevent damage. For indoor chaises, vacuuming upholstery and attending to spills promptly keeps the fabric in good condition. Periodically check for any structural issues, such as loose screws or joints, and address them to maintain safety and comfort.
